Aida Turturro Biography

Birth Name:Aida Turturro

Birth Place:Brooklyn, New York City, New York, United States

Profession Actress, Soundtrack

Fast Facts

  • Has worked to raise awareness of rheumatoid arthritis among the general public
  • Graduated from the State University of New York, New Paltz, in 1984 as a theatre major
  • In her senior year of college, she played Mayor Dawgmeat in her school's production of "Li'l Abner․"
  • Played mob boss Tony Soprano's sister on "The Sopranos" from 1999 to 2007, the role she would come to be most recognized for
  • Frequently co-starred with her friend James Gandolfini on the big screen, the small screen and stage before his death in 2013
  • Served as a celebrity spokesperson for a diabetes awareness campaign sponsored by Sanofi-Aventis in 2007
  • Bought a black lab to help inspire her to stay active
